Research and Assignments

The ability to conduct research efficiently is a fundamental skill for college success. Laptops enable students to navigate online libraries, databases, and academic journals seamlessly. Additionally, the convenience of typing and editing allows for a more streamlined approach to completing assignments. Gone are the days of wrestling with handwritten drafts; now, students can quickly refine their work.

Digital Note-Taking

The days of lugging around stacks of notebooks are fading as digital note-taking becomes the norm. Laptops offer organization and accessibility, allowing students to store, search, and retrieve notes effortlessly. This reduces physical clutter and ensures essential information is always at their fingertips.

Communication and Collaboration

Laptops facilitate communication with professors and peers. Emails, virtual office hours, and online forums allow students to seek clarification and engage in discussions. Collaborative projects and group discussions are also streamlined through digital platforms, fostering a sense of community in the virtual realm.

Choosing the Right Laptop

Selecting the right laptop for college is a crucial decision. Factors such as processing power, storage capacity, and durability should be considered based on the student’s specific needs. Fortunately, the market offers a variety of budget-friendly options that cater to various academic requirements.

Security Measures

With the increasing reliance on digital platforms, protecting sensitive information becomes paramount. College students must know the importance of antivirus software and other security measures to safeguard their academic and personal data.
